Subject: [PATCH 4/4] selftests/kvm: smoke test support for RAPL_DIS

If the hardware supports the RAPL_DIS policy bit and the ccp has been
loaded with the RAPL_DIS bit set, make sure a VM can
actually start using it.

tools/testing/selftests/kvm/include/x86/sev.h | 1 +
.../selftests/kvm/x86/sev_smoke_test.c | 24 ++++++++++++++++++-
2 files changed, 24 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/tools/testing/selftests/kvm/include/x86/sev.h b/tools/testing/selftests/kvm/include/x86/sev.h
index fd11f4222ec2..e9a566ff6df1 100644
--- a/tools/testing/selftests/kvm/include/x86/sev.h
+++ b/tools/testing/selftests/kvm/include/x86/sev.h
@@ -28,6 +28,7 @@ enum sev_guest_state {
#define SNP_POLICY_SMT (1ULL << 16)
#define SNP_POLICY_RSVD_MBO (1ULL << 17)
#define SNP_POLICY_DBG (1ULL << 19)
+#define SNP_POLICY_RAPL_DIS (1ULL << 23)
#define GHCB_MSR_TERM_REQ 0x100
diff --git a/tools/testing/selftests/kvm/x86/sev_smoke_test.c b/tools/testing/selftests/kvm/x86/sev_smoke_test.c
index c7fda9fc324b..e4cf5b99b19a 100644
--- a/tools/testing/selftests/kvm/x86/sev_smoke_test.c
+++ b/tools/testing/selftests/kvm/x86/sev_smoke_test.c
@@ -248,6 +248,18 @@ static bool sev_es_allowed(void)
return supported;
}
+static u64 supported_policy_mask(void)
+{
+ int kvm_fd = open_kvm_dev_path_or_exit();
+ u64 policy_mask = 0;
+
+ kvm_device_attr_get(kvm_fd, KVM_X86_GRP_SEV,
+ KVM_X86_SNP_POLICY_BITS,
+ &policy_mask);
+ close(kvm_fd);
+ return policy_mask;
+}
+
int main(int argc, char *argv[])
{
TEST_REQUIRE(kvm_cpu_has(X86_FEATURE_SEV));
@@ -257,8 +269,18 @@ int main(int argc, char *argv[])
if (sev_es_allowed())
test_sev_smoke(guest_sev_es_code, KVM_X86_SEV_ES_VM, SEV_POLICY_ES);
- if (kvm_cpu_has(X86_FEATURE_SEV_SNP))
+ if (kvm_cpu_has(X86_FEATURE_SEV_SNP)) {
+ int supported_policy = supported_policy_mask();
+
test_sev_smoke(guest_snp_code, KVM_X86_SNP_VM, snp_default_policy());
+ if (supported_policy & SNP_POLICY_RAPL_DIS &&
+ kvm_get_module_param_bool("ccp", "rapl_disable")) {
+ uint32_t policy = snp_default_policy() | SNP_POLICY_RAPL_DIS;
+
+ test_sev_smoke(guest_snp_code, KVM_X86_SNP_VM, policy);
+ }
+ }
+
return 0;
}
